Central to any betting action is the concept of odds. Odds depict both the chance of a result and also the reward for predicting it effectively. They appear in different formats—fractional (popular in the united kingdom), decimal (used broadly in Europe), and moneyline (common inside the US). Fractional odds exhibit the earnings relative into the stake, decimal odds show the total return, and moneyline odds suggest just how much a person really should bet to earn $a hundred or just how much will likely be gained from a $one hundred stake. Learning the way to interpret odds is essential for placing intelligent bets, as it can help identify no matter if a potential wager delivers fantastic price.
